Insurance Coverage for Cranial Prostheses (Medical Wigs)

At Hair As Prescribed Rx LLC, we understand that experiencing hair loss due to a medical condition or treatment can be overwhelming. Our goal is to make the process of obtaining a high-quality cranial prosthesis (medical wig) as simple and stress-free as possible.

 

Many health insurance plans may provide coverage or reimbursement for a cranial prosthesis when it is considered medically necessary. Coverage varies by insurance carrier and individual policy, so we are here to help you understand the process.

 

What Is a Cranial Prosthesis?

 

A cranial prosthesis is a medical device designed for individuals experiencing hair loss due to a medical condition or treatment. Unlike a fashion wig, a cranial prosthesis is prescribed to help restore confidence, comfort, and quality of life.

 

Medical conditions that may qualify include:

- Cancer treatment (chemotherapy or radiation)

- Alopecia - Burns or scalp trauma

- Certain autoimmune disorders

- Other medically related hair-loss conditions

What You May Need

 

Insurance requirements vary, but many plans may request:

- A prescription from your physician for a cranial prosthesis (medical wig)

- A medical diagnosis - Your insurance card

- A government-issued photo ID

- Any additional documentation requested by your insurance company

 

We recommend contacting your insurance provider to verify your specific benefits before your appointment.

Questions For Your Insurance Company

Does my plan cover a cranial prosthesis (medical wig)?

Is a physician's prescription required?

Do I need prior authorization?

Is Hair As Prescribed Rx LLC an in-network provider?

What documentation is required for reimbursement or coverage?

Are there any deductibles, copays, or coverage limits?

Do I need to purchase the cranial prosthesis before submitting a claim?
